Best Time to Visit Nan

When planning a vacation to Nan, it's essential to consider the best time to visit. The city experiences a tropical climate, with temperatures varying throughout the year. Generally, the weather is warm, with average temperatures ranging from 20°C to 35°C. The cooler months, typically from November to February, are particularly pleasant, making it an ideal time for outdoor activities and sightseeing. During this period, the humidity is lower, and the skies are often clear, providing perfect conditions for exploring the city's attractions.

As the year progresses, temperatures can rise, especially during the hot season from March to May, where it can reach up to 40°C. The rainy season, which usually occurs from May to October, brings heavy showers and increased humidity. While this may deter some travelers, the lush landscapes and vibrant greenery during this time can be quite enchanting. Ultimately, the best time to visit Nan is during the cooler months, when the weather is most favorable for enjoying all that this beautiful city has to offer.

Top Sights of the City

Nan is home to several remarkable sights that showcase its rich cultural heritage and natural beauty. Here are five top places to visit in and around the city:

  • Wat Phumin: This iconic temple is famous for its intricate murals and unique architecture, making it a must-visit for anyone interested in Thai culture.

  • Nan National Museum: Housed in a former royal palace, this museum offers a comprehensive overview of the region's history, art, and culture.

  • Doi Phu Kha National Park: Just a short drive from the city, this national park is perfect for nature lovers, offering hiking trails, stunning views, and diverse wildlife.

  • Wat Chang Kham: This ancient temple features a beautiful Lanna-style chedi and is a great place to learn about the region's spiritual heritage.

  • Nan Riverside Art Gallery: This contemporary art gallery showcases the work of local artists and provides a unique perspective on the region's artistic scene.

These sights not only highlight the beauty of Nan but also provide visitors with a deeper understanding of its cultural significance.

Accommodations for Your Vacation in Nan

When it comes to finding the perfect place to stay in Nan, visitors have a variety of accommodation options to choose from. The city offers everything from budget-friendly guesthouses to luxurious villas, catering to different preferences and budgets.

For those looking for a more authentic experience, renting a traditional Thai house or villa can be a great option. Prices for these accommodations typically range from 1,500 to 5,000 THB per night, depending on the size and location. Many of these properties are situated near the city center, providing easy access to local attractions and amenities.

If you prefer a more modern setting, there are several hotels and boutique accommodations available, with prices ranging from 1,000 to 3,000 THB per night. These establishments often offer additional amenities such as swimming pools, restaurants, and guided tours, making them a convenient choice for families and travelers seeking comfort.

For those on a tighter budget, guesthouses and hostels are plentiful in Nan, with prices starting as low as 300 THB per night. These options provide a more communal atmosphere, allowing travelers to meet others and share experiences.
